You can frame (build) walls with studs placed at various distances. The most commonly used distances for stud placing in a wall are 16 inches, 19.2 inches, and 2 feet on centers (O.C.). All the major log rules use the small end diameter, inside the bark, as the basic size measurement. If the log is not perfectly round, then two readings are taken at 90 degrees to each other and averaged. Each unit will have four shelves, and each shelf will be divided into two cubbies each sized perfectly to fit our storage bins:A bunk is a term used to describe a full unit of lumber. Each size of lumber has a different quantity. For example, 2×4 s have 294 pcs, 2×6 s have 189 pcs, 2×8 s have 147 pcs (unless you are purchasing yellow pine and then they have 96 pcs), 2×10 YP have 80 pcs and finally 2×12 YP have 64 pcs. You can calculate board feet by multiplying the board's thickness in inches by the width in inches by the length in inches and then dividing the result by 144. Thus, the formula to calculate board footage is (thickness × width × length) ÷ 144. Make sure you keep all measurements in inches, then divide by 144. BF = Thickness [in] × Width ...

Sawhorses made from 2x4s are a handy tool for many DIY ...The number of teeth on a saw blade depends on its type and length. Available options generally include: Combination : 10-inch blades with 50 teeth and 12-inch with 60 teeth. Ripping : 10-inch blades with 24-30 teeth and 12-inch blades with 40 or fewer teeth. Now you'll have 8 full 2x4s, 4 6-foot 2x4s, and 8 ...Step Three: Calculate the Number of Studs Needed. To calculate the number of studs you need, divide the length of the wall by the stud on-center spacing. For example, if you are framing a 13′ wall (156″) with a 16″ OC spacing, then divide 156″ inches by 16″, which is 9.75. 156″ ÷ 16″ = 9.75. Be sure to round up to the nearest ...

In a Bundle, How Many 2x4s Do You Have? In a bundle, there are approximately 294 2x4s. This is based on 1,568 foot board measures in bundle size. A 2x4x8 measures 5.33 feet on a board.
